What is the function of the airbag control unit K8820-3NA0A?
The component K8820-3NA0A is a central sensor for the side airbag, also referred to as the "Sensor-Side Airbag Center," and a key part of the airbag control unit in the Nissan Leaf ZE0 (2010–2017). It is part of the Supplemental Restraint System (SRS) and responsible for processing sensor data and controlling airbag deployment.
The control unit with part number K8820-3NA0A is an original Nissan replacement part specifically designed for the first generation of the Nissan Leaf. Its primary task is to monitor signals from various vehicle sensors and, in the event of a crash, activate the appropriate restraint systems, such as the side airbags.
As an integral component of the SRS, this unit ensures occupant safety at all times. It works closely with other components, such as seatbelt pretensioners and main airbags, to provide coordinated protection.
Why does the control unit K8820-3NA0A fail?
Defects in the K8820-3NA0A control unit often arise from external factors, such as broken wiring, faulty connectors, or erroneous signals from sensors—especially the seat occupancy sensor. Internally, stored crash data after an accident or electronic component failures, like defective capacitors, can also block its functionality.
The most common sources of failure are not always located within the control unit itself but rather in its peripherals. These include damaged or improperly routed cables, loose connectors, or corroded contacts that disrupt communication between sensors and the control unit.
Another significant cause of failure is malfunctioning sensors that send incorrect data to the control unit. The seat occupancy sensor, in particular, is a well-known weak point. If this sensor malfunctions, the control unit interprets it as a system error.
After a crash, the control unit stores so‑called “crash data,” which the system locks out for safety reasons. This lock is permanent and can only be lifted through specialized repair. Internal hardware defects on the circuit board, such as faulty capacitors, can also lead to total failure. In these cases, repair is almost always possible and more cost-effective than replacement.
How do you recognize a defect in the K8820-3NA0A?
The clearest symptom of a defect in the K8820-3NA0A control unit is the continuously illuminated SRS warning light (airbag warning light) in the instrument cluster. This warning indicates that the entire airbag system is disabled and would not deploy in the event of a crash, requiring immediate inspection.
The activated warning light is not merely advisory—it is a critical safety signal. During vehicle startup, the system performs a self‑test; if a fault is detected in the SRS circuit of the K8820-3NA0A or one of its components, the light remains on.
In a professional workshop, an OBD tool is connected to the vehicle for precise diagnosis. Using the fault memory, the diagnostic code can be read, revealing whether the issue lies in the wiring, a sensor, or directly in the K8820-3NA0A control unit.
In which vehicles is the K8820-3NA0A installed?
The airbag control unit with part number K8820-3NA0A was developed specifically for Nissan vehicles. It is used exclusively in the first generation of the Nissan Leaf electric car, produced between 2010 and 2017.
At Airbag24, we repair the K8820-3NA0A control unit for the following model:
Nissan: Leaf ZE0 (model years 2010–2017), particularly suitable for models from 2011 and 2012 onward.
How is the K8820-3NA0A control unit professionally repaired?
At Airbag24, repairs to the K8820-3NA0A follow a certified process. Upon receipt, the unit undergoes electronic analysis to identify issues such as stored crash data or defective components. Defects are then corrected, data is reset, and the unit is returned after a functional test with a 12-month warranty.
The process ideally begins in your workshop with reading the fault memory to rule out external causes. After proper removal, you send the control unit to Airbag24.
Here, our technicians perform a comprehensive incoming inspection, including visual checks of the circuit board and solder joints, as well as thorough electronic diagnostics. Based on the analysis, stored crash data is erased, and defective electronic components, such as capacitors, are replaced with new, high‑quality parts.
After successful repair, the control unit undergoes a final functional test to ensure full compatibility and proper operation. You will receive a fully restored component, backed by a 12-month warranty.
